Containers are “lightweight,” which means they share the machine’s operating system kernel and do not Cloud deployment require the overhead of associating an working system within every application. Containers are inherently smaller in capability than VMs and require much less start-up time. This functionality allows way more containers to run on the identical compute capacity as a single VM. This functionality drives higher server efficiencies and, in flip, reduces server and licensing costs. For organizations weighing some great advantages of containerization, the counsel of seasoned professionals is a game-changer.

Containerization supports DevOps and agile methodologies by facilitating continuous integration and steady deployment (CI/CD) pipelines, enabling fast iteration, and making certain consistency across completely different environments. Its ability to seamlessly combine with future technological advancements and adapt to altering regulatory landscapes positions it as a cornerstone of digital transformation methods. Organizations that leverage container technologies successfully will find themselves on the forefront of innovation, geared up to tackle the challenges of a quickly evolving digital world. As containerization technology matures and turns into extra integral to enterprise and IT infrastructure, the evolution of container requirements and regulations is changing into more and more important.

Their versatility and efficiency have made them a well-liked choice for quite a few scenarios. For instance, Docker is a well-liked type of containerization that allows software builders to package their applications into standardized isolated containers. Docker makes it easier for applications to run on any system, no matter its underlying infrastructure. As A Outcome Of container applications can run on cloud servers, they are generally extra accessible than different functions.

Linux containers are self-contained environments that permit a quantity of Linux-based functions to run on a single host machine. Software developers use Linux containers to deploy applications containerization definition that write or read massive amounts of data. Linux containers do not copy the complete working system to their virtualized surroundings. Instead, the containers include needed functionalities allotted in the Linux namespace. Containerization includes building self-sufficient software program packages that carry out consistently, whatever the machines they run on.

Idc Infobrief: The State Of Containerization Infrastructure

containerization definition

This permits developers to focus on working on a particular space of an software, without impacting the app’s general performance. Container orchestration or container management is mostly used in the context of utility containers.10 Implementations offering such orchestration embrace Kubernetes and Docker swarm. Builders use containerization to construct and deploy fashionable applications due to the following advantages.

Serverless Containers

Additionally, container registries can retailer multiple versions of container photographs, allowing easy rollbacks to earlier variations if needed. This ability enhances the reliability and stability of utility deployment. The Kubernetes ecosystem is broad and sophisticated and no single technology vendor offers all the parts of an entire on-prem trendy applications stack.

containerization definition

The reason cloud services corporations exist is just because managing servers is costly from a management perspective and costly as an tools perspective. While they deal with many of the cloud problems, it is still up to you to make your containers and deploy them onto their service. Cloud Foundry’s Garden is an open source possibility that provides containerization as part of its Platform-as-a-Service choices (PaaS). Cloud Foundry is the host for developing, testing, and deploying portable functions on a cloud server.

  • At Present an organization may need tons of or hundreds of containers—an amount that would be nearly inconceivable for groups to manage manually.
  • Docker supplies a comprehensive set of tools for developing, shipping, and running containerized applications.
  • Organizations seeking to build cloud functions with microservices require containerization technology.
  • We believe Nutanix hyperconverged Infrastructure (HCI) is the perfect infrastructure foundation for containerized workloads running on Kubernetes at scale.
  • DevOps loves containerization, especially as a outcome of it offers the good thing about reproducibility.

The YAML file is a configuration file that tells the Kubernetes servers exactly what the container’s necessities are to run. Fast-track your method to production-ready Kubernetes and simplify lifecycle administration. Containers are much smaller, usually measured by the megabyte and never packaging anything bigger than an app and its working surroundings.

A zero-trust security strategy also authenticates and authorizes every gadget, community move and connection based mostly on dynamic insurance policies, by using context from as many knowledge sources as possible. Containers are “lightweight,” which means they share the machine’s working system (OS) kernel. This function not only drives higher server efficiencies but additionally reduces server and licensing costs whereas speeding up begin times, as there is not any operating system in addition.

This portability speeds growth, prevents cloud vendor lock-in and presents other notable benefits like fault isolation, ease of management, simplified security and extra. Particularly focusing on the application layer, these containers encapsulate an software and its dependencies, but not a full operating system. Docker is once more a popular choice right here, alongside different tools like rkt (Rocket).

This may end in bugs, errors, and glitches that needed fixing (meaning more time, less productivity, and a lot of frustration). Container images are the top layer in a containerized system that consists of the following layers. First and foremost, container safety policies should revolve round a zero belief framework. This mannequin verifies and authorizes every consumer connection and ensures that the interplay https://www.globalcloudteam.com/ meets the conditional requirements of the organization’s safety insurance policies.